    I will be installing my lift probably the end of this month. A member on here will be installing the ECGS clamshell bushing for me as well. Was piecing it together, wanted to wait for the HS aal to be back in stock since you don't have to trim the factory retainer clips. I also ordered the 1/2 shims a few days later from HS to get the 2" lift.

    I'm going with 6112/5160 set on 6/5 circlip and also waiting for my new wheels, SCS Matte Gunmetal Ray10s 17x8.5 -10 with 265/70/17 wildpeaks.
